POSITION SUMMARY

The Engineering Technician will provide hands on fabricating, assembling, testing, evaluating, and documenting related to light duty pick-up truck and Jeep accessory products in a research and development environment. The responsibilities within this role will involve a broad range of products including Bed Covers (a.k.a. Tonneau Covers), Styling Bars, Chase/Headache Racks, Step Bars, Latches and Mechanisms, and chassis components. This position will require a highly adaptable, hands-on technician who is a skilled fabricator in machining, welding, and assembly. This position will utilize skills to set-up and operate test equipment for basic function tests including load, deflection, cyclic durability, and test buck construction. In the case of testing, this position will be required to capture and document key test data. Additionally, the Engineering Technician will be required to follow the best safety practices while performing all job duties.

CORE FUNCTIONS

Fabrication: Follow direction provided by Engineering and utilize machine shop equipment (including but not limited to Drill Press, Band Saw, Panel Saw, Blast Cabinet, Press, Press Brake, Lathe, Tube Bender, CNC Mill, CNC Plasma Cutter, MIG Welder, TIG Welder, Fabrication Table, 3D Printers, etc.) to make precision-fabricated components and assemblies that meet required dimensional specifications per CAD design.

    • Work in accordance with test procedure standards and regulatory guidelines.
    • Maintain an organized and clean shop area and assist in ship housekeeping, as required.
    • Communicate directly with engineering supervisors regarding the status of fabrication and test schedules.
    • Read fine scales, dials, and indicators of measurement devices.
    • Safely operate machine tools such as lathes, milling machines, band saws, plasma cutters, and grinders.
    • Recommend equipment changes and additions to increase safety and productivity.
    • Perform basic care and maintenance of all shop and test equipment.
    • Track cutting tool life and replace dull tools.

Testing/Design Validation: Perform product analysis and design validation (DV) test activities for existing and new products for commercial viability, durability, and functionality.

    • Analyze and evaluate data and/or systems to determine if validation criteria were met or exceeded.
    • Identify mechanical problems/root cause analysis of component and system level testing.
    • Employ measurement devices for length, force, torque, thermal, impact, humidity, and mass.
    • Compile, categorize, tabulate, or verify information or data to provide detailed report summaries.
    • Document test procedures and results in drafted detailed reports.
    • Detect changes in circumstances, events, or alarms, and assess problems.
